Default Versys Riders Location Google Map

Click here for access to the Versys Riders Map!

Per a great suggestion on another post, I made a Google map showing our geographic locations. This map is a great way to find out who is close to us. If you want to be added to this map, reply here with your zip code (if in USA) and I will add your screen name to the map.

More Accurate Pin Placement (A couple different methods): Please go to www.maps.google.com and search for the address where you want your pin to appear (as shown below). Click the link button, check the short URL box, then copy the short URL and paste it in your post. I can use that information to easily and accurately add you to the map!


Another way to post your location is to use the coordinate method by finding the place on the map you wish your pin to be and right click and select "What's Here?" When the coordinates appear in the search field, copy them and paste in your reply.


If you are outside the USA, please use the short URL or Coordinate method as described above. Thanks!

Also, if you want to add a photo, the image must be hosted online. Feel free to send a link to that image and I will be glad to add it to the map! I will also go back and add images if you already have a pin on the map, just let me know! Example of my photo on the map.



I restricted access to edit the map because it would only take one person to hack or mess up the map. If you later want to be removed, simply ask & I will gladly honor your request.
